Who funds Leadership Akron?

Leadership Akron is funded by 21 grantmakers, led by Akron Community Foundation ($1.0M), United Way of Summit and Medina ($239K), Sisler Mcfawn Foundation Pfdn ($148K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$1.6M in grants to Leadership Akron between 2019–2025.
